For the purpose of this Regulation the following definitions shall apply: 'Union waters' means the waters under the sovereignty or jurisdiction of the Member States, with the exception of the waters adjacent to the territories listed in Annex II to the Treaty; 'marine biological resources' means available and accessible living marine aquatic species, including anadromous and catadromous species during their marine life; 'fresh water biological resources' means available and accessible living fresh water aquatic species; 'fishing vessel' means any vessel equipped for commercial exploitation of marine biological resources or a blue fin tuna trap; 'Union fishing vessel' means a fishing vessel flying the flag of a Member State and registered in the Union; 'entry to the fishing fleet' means registration of a fishing vessel in the fishing vessel register of a Member State; 'maximum sustainable yield' means the highest theoretical equilibrium yield that can be continuously taken on average from a stock under existing average environmental conditions without significantly affecting the reproduction process; 'precautionary approach to fisheries management', as referred to in Article 6 of the UN Fish Stocks Agreement, means an approach according to which the absence of adequate scientific information should not justify postponing or failing to take management measures to conserve target species, associated or dependent species and non-target species and their environment; 'ecosystem-based approach to fisheries management' means an integrated approach to managing fisheries within ecologically meaningful boundaries which seeks to manage the use of natural resources, taking account of fishing and other human activities, while preserving both the biological wealth and the biological processes necessary to safeguard the composition, structure and functioning of the habitats of the ecosystem affected, by taking into account the knowledge and uncertainties regarding biotic, abiotic and human components of ecosystems; 'discards' means catches that are returned to the sea; 'low impact fishing' means utilising selective fishing techniques which have a low detrimental impact on marine ecosystems or which may result in low fuel emissions, or both; 'selective fishing' means fishing with fishing methods or fishing gears that target and capture organisms by size or species during the fishing operation, allowing non-target specimens to be avoided or released unharmed; 'fishing mortality rate' means the rate at which biomass or individuals are removed from a stock by means of fishery activities over a given period; 'stock' means a marine biological resource that occurs in a given management area; 'catch limit' means, as appropriate, either a quantitative limit on catches of a fish stock or group of fish stocks over a given period where such fish stocks or group of fish stocks are subject to an obligation to land, or a quantitative limit on landings of a fish stock or group of fish stocks over a given period for which the obligation to land does not apply; 'conservation reference point' means values of fish stock population parameters (such as biomass or fishing mortality rate) used in fisheries management, for example in respect of an acceptable level of biological risk or a desired level of yield; 'minimum conservation reference size' means the size of a living marine aquatic species taking into account maturity, as established by Union law, below which restrictions or incentives apply that aim to avoid capture through fishing activity; such size replaces, where relevant, the minimum landing size; 'stock within safe biological limits' means a stock with a high probability that its estimated spawning biomass at the end of the previous year is higher than the limit biomass reference point (Blim) and its estimated fishing mortality rate for the previous year is less than the limit fishing mortality rate reference point (Flim); 'safeguard' means a precautionary measure designed to avoid something undesirable occurring; 'technical measure' means a measure that regulates the composition of catches by species and size and the impacts on components of the ecosystems resulting from fishing activities by establishing conditions for the use and structure of fishing gear and restrictions on access to fishing areas; 'fishing effort' means the product of the capacity and the activity of a fishing vessel; for a group of fishing vessels it is the sum of the fishing effort of all vessels in the group; 'Member State having a direct management interest' means a Member State which has an interest consisting of either fishing opportunities or a fishery taking place in the exclusive economic zone of the Member State concerned, or, in the Mediterranean Sea, a traditional fishery on the high seas; 'transferable fishing concession' means a revocable user entitlement to a specific part of fishing opportunities allocated to a Member State or established in a management plan adopted by a Member State in accordance with Article 19 of Council Regulation (EC) No1967/2006(18), which the holder may transfer; 'fishing capacity' means a vessel's tonnage in GT (Gross Tonnage) and its power in kW (Kilowatt) as defined in Articles 4 and 5 of Council Regulation (EEC) No2930/86(19); 'aquaculture' means the rearing or cultivation of aquatic organisms using techniques designed to increase the production of the organisms in question beyond the natural capacity of the environment, where the organisms remain the property of a natural or legal person throughout the rearing and culture stage, up to and including harvesting; 'fishing licence' means a licence as defined in point (9) of Article 4 of Council Regulation (EC) No1224/2009(20); 'fishing authorisation' means an authorisation as defined in point (10) of Article 4 of Regulation (EC) No1224/2009; 'fishing activity' means searching for fish, shooting, setting, towing, hauling of a fishing gear, taking catch on board, transhipping, retaining on board, processing on board, transferring, caging, fattening and landing of fish and fishery products; 'fishery products' means aquatic organisms resulting from any fishing activity or products derived therefrom; 'operator' means the natural or legal person who operates or holds any undertaking carrying out any of the activities related to any stage of production, processing, marketing, distribution and retail chains of fisheries and aquaculture products; 'serious infringement' means an infringement that is defined as such in relevant Union law, including in Article 42(1) of Council Regulation (EC) No1005/2008(21) and in Article 90(1) of Regulation (EC) No1224/2009; 'end-user of scientific data' means a body with a research or management interest in the scientific analysis of data in the fisheries sector; 'surplus of allowable catch' means that part of the allowable catch which a coastal State does not harvest, resulting in an overall exploitation rate for individual stocks that remains below levels at which stocks are capable of restoring themselves and maintaining populations of harvested species above desired levels based on the best available scientific advice; 'aquaculture products' means aquatic organisms at any stage of their life cycle resulting from any aquaculture activity or products derived therefrom; 'spawning stock biomass' means an estimate of the mass of the fish of a particular stock that reproduces at a defined time, including both males and females and fish that reproduce viviparously; 'mixed fisheries' means fisheries in which more than one species is present and where different species are likely to be caught in the same fishing operation; 'sustainable fisheries partnership agreement' means an international agreement concluded with a third state for the purpose of obtaining access to waters and resources in order to sustainably exploit a share of the surplus of marine biological resources, in exchange for financial compensation from the Union, which may include sectoral support. 5. As appropriate and without prejudice to the respective competences under the Treaty, a multiannual plan shall include: the scope, in terms of stocks, fishery and the area to which the multiannual plan shall be applied; objectives that are consistent with the objectives set out in Article 2 and with the relevant provisions of Articles 6 and 9; quantifiable targets such as fishing mortality rates and/or spawning stock biomass; clear time-frames to reach the quantifiable targets; conservation reference points consistent with the objectives set out in Article 2; objectives for conservation and technical measures to be taken in order to achieve the targets set out in Article 15, and measures designed to avoid and reduce, as far as possible, unwanted catches; safeguards to ensure that quantifiable targets are met, as well as remedial action, where needed, including for situations where the deteriorating quality of data or non-availability put the sustainability of the stock at risk. Measures for the conservation and sustainable exploitation of marine biological resources may include, inter alia, the following: multiannual plans under Articles 9 and 10; targets for the conservation and sustainable exploitation of stocks and related measures to minimise the impact of fishing on the marine environment; measures to adapt the fishing capacity of fishing vessels to available fishing opportunities; incentives, including those of an economic nature, such as fishing opportunities, to promote fishing methods that contribute to more selective fishing, to the avoidance and reduction, as far as possible, of unwanted catches, and to fishing with low impact on the marine ecosystem and fishery resources; measures on the fixing and allocation of fishing opportunities; measures to achieve the objectives of Article 15; pilot projects on alternative types of fishing management techniques and on gears that increase selectivity or that minimise the negative impact of fishing activities on the marine environment; measures necessary for compliance with obligations under Union environmental legislation adopted pursuant to Article 11; technical measures as referred to in paragraph 2.
